What is an Insulin Cooling Travel Case and Why is it Important for Travelers?
An insulin cooling travel case is a portable device designed to maintain the optimal temperature for insulin storage. This ensures that insulin remains effective for use, especially when traveling. The case protects insulin from extreme temperatures and is essential for individuals with diabetes.
According to the American Diabetes Association, proper storage of insulin is crucial for maintaining its potency. Insulin should ideally be stored between 36°F and 46°F (2°C and 8°C) to maintain its effectiveness. When exposed to temperatures outside this range, insulin can degrade, leading to ineffective treatment.
The insulin cooling travel case works by using special materials or technology to regulate temperature. These cases often include gel packs or built-in refrigeration systems. Travelers benefit from these cases during flights or road trips where temperature control can be challenging.

How Does a Portable, TSA-Ready Insulin Cooler Operate?
A portable, TSA-ready insulin cooler operates by maintaining a controlled temperature environment suitable for storing insulin. These coolers typically utilize a combination of insulation and refrigeration technology to ensure that the insulin stays within the required temperature range, usually between 36°F and 46°F (2°C to 8°C).
Key features of these coolers include:
| Feature | Description |
|---|---|
| Insulation | High-quality insulation materials that prevent heat transfer, keeping the contents cool. |
| Cooling Technology | Some coolers use ice packs or gel packs that can be frozen prior to use, while others may have battery-operated cooling systems. |
| TSA Compliance | Designed to meet TSA regulations for travel, ensuring that they can be carried on flights without issues. |
| Portability | Lightweight and compact design for easy transport. |
| Temperature Monitoring | Some models include temperature indicators or alarms to alert users if the temperature rises outside the safe range. |
| Battery Life | Duration of cooling operation on battery power, typically ranging from several hours to a full day. |
| Capacity | Volume of insulin vials or pens that the cooler can accommodate, which can vary by model. |
These coolers are essential for individuals with diabetes, allowing them to travel without compromising the efficacy of their insulin.

Why is it Critical to Use Ice Packs for Insulin Storage While Traveling?
It is critical to use ice packs for insulin storage while traveling to maintain the correct temperature required for insulin efficacy. Insulin needs to be stored between 36°F (2°C) and 46°F (8°C) to ensure its stability and effectiveness.
The American Diabetes Association provides guidelines stating that insulin should be kept at specific temperatures to avoid loss of potency. If insulin is exposed to temperatures above the recommended range, it can become ineffective, leading to poor blood sugar control.
The underlying cause of the need for temperature regulation in insulin storage stems from the chemical structure of insulin. Insulin is a protein hormone, and proteins can denature or lose their functional structure when exposed to heat. Denatured insulin cannot effectively lower blood glucose levels. Also, freezing insulin can cause crystallization, which damages the insulin and makes it unusable.
Important technical terms include denaturation, which refers to the process where proteins lose their natural structure due to external stressors like heat. This change in structure leads to a loss of biological activity. Additionally, insulin stability is crucial for maintaining its effectiveness in glucose regulation.
Using ice packs while traveling helps to regulate the temperature of insulin. For instance, when traveling by air or in warm weather, cool packs can keep the insulin away from heat sources that may arise during travel. If insulin is stored without temperature control, such as in a hot car or exposed to sunlight, it risks becoming ineffective.
Specific scenarios include leaving insulin in a hot vehicle, which can exceed safe temperature ranges quickly. Another example is taking insulin on long flights, where temperature fluctuations may occur due to cabin conditions. Failure to use proper cooling methods in these situations can result in ineffective insulin and compromised glucose management.
